SAN FRANCISCO -- The Workers' Compensation Insurance Rating Bureau's governing committee July 22 voted to recommend an overall 3.6 percent increase for 1999 to California advisory pure premium rates.The recommendation will be forwarded to Chuck Quackenbush, state insurance commissioner, whose department will study the matter and in turn make a final decision.Last year Quackenbush ordered a pure premium rate decrease of 2.5 percent, despite the Bureau's request for a .5 percent increase.
